Output 8d741581e64e2121ea6223957fe891a0bbd4a1b2e4faca302416d41ffdcad0f3:1

value
42086315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4cace4a7c98e78aefe99411faf0e117e2f823ff OP_EQUAL
address
3Q1MkYdE95z8WUdherwVEy2XZ1CXofkCDh
transaction
8d741581e64e2121ea6223957fe891a0bbd4a1b2e4faca302416d41ffdcad0f3
spent
true